Add 18/27 and 12/30
18/27 + 12/30 is 16/15.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 27 and 30 is 270
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 270 - For the 1st fraction, since 27 × 10 = 270,
18/27 = 18 × 10/27 × 10 = 180/270 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 30 × 9 = 270,
12/30 = 12 × 9/30 × 9 = 108/270 - Add the two like fractions:
180/270 + 108/270 = 180 + 108/270 = 288/270 - 288/270 simplified gives 16/15
- So, 18/27 + 12/30 = 16/15
